How Community Science Ignites Curiosity, Fosters Inclusion, and Drives Discovery

March 6, 2026
in General, People
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

At the Yale School of Public Health, community science is emerging as a powerful catalyst for curiosity, inclusion, and discovery. By engaging diverse populations in collaborative research efforts, this approach breaks down traditional barriers between scientists and the public, fostering a shared pursuit of knowledge and solutions to pressing health challenges. As the School champions community-driven initiatives, it not only advances scientific understanding but also promotes equity and empowerment, redefining the future of public health research.

Community Science Drives Inclusive Public Health Research at Yale

At Yale School of Public Health, community science is revolutionizing how research is conducted by fostering a collaborative environment where local voices are integral to the scientific process. This inclusive approach not only empowers participants but also ensures that findings are rooted in lived experiences, bridging gaps between researchers and residents. From urban neighborhoods to rural areas, community members actively contribute to data collection, problem identification, and solution design, cultivating a shared curiosity that accelerates discovery and innovation in public health.

The impact of this model is far-reaching, highlighting several key benefits that redefine traditional research paradigms:

  • Enhanced trust: Genuine partnerships between scientists and communities foster transparency and mutual respect.
  • Improved data accuracy: Local insights contribute to richer, context-specific information that drives targeted interventions.
  • Capacity building: Community members develop skills and knowledge, strengthening local public health infrastructure.
Community Group Project Focus Outcome
New Haven Youth Council Air quality monitoring Policy recommendations adopted
Fair Haven Residents Chronic disease prevention Educational workshops hosted
Elm City Seniors Nutrition assessment Improved meal programs

Expanding community participation in scientific initiatives requires a multifaceted approach that prioritizes accessibility and engagement. Simplifying complex scientific concepts through visual aids, interactive workshops, and multilingual resources can attract a broader audience. Incorporating local voices by hosting town halls and facilitating dialogue with researchers fosters trust and inclusivity. Additionally, leveraging digital platforms to create user-friendly portals allows participants to easily contribute data and track project progress from anywhere, reducing barriers caused by geography or time constraints.

Key strategies include:

  • Partnering with schools and community centers to integrate citizen science into curriculums and events.
  • Offering incentives such as recognition programs and certificates to acknowledge contributions.
  • Utilizing social media campaigns to raise awareness and encourage peer-to-peer sharing.
Strategy Benefit
Interactive Workshops Hands-on learning boosts retention and enthusiasm
Multilingual Content Reaches diverse communities and promotes inclusion
Digital Platforms Enables widespread participation and real-time engagement
